Are Japanese macaque mammals or reptiles?

Japanese Macaques, which are also known as "snow monkeys", are mammals. Mammals are warm blooded, have hair or fur on their bodies and give birth to live young. Reptiles are cold blooded and lay eggs instead of live young. Some examples of reptiles are snakes and lizards, and some examples of mammals are monkeys, dogs, and humans.
